Gross enrolment ratio, primary, adjusted gender parity index in Slovenia
Slovenia: Gross enrolment ratio, primary, adjusted gender parity index was 0.9928 GPIA in 2023. ▬ Flat
Gross enrolment ratio, primary, adjusted gender parity index in Slovenia, 2001–2023
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in GPIA.
Analysis
In 2023, gross enrolment ratio, primary, adjusted gender parity index in Slovenia stood at 0.9928 GPIA.
That represents a change of down 0.1% on the previous year and down 0.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gross enrolment ratio, primary, adjusted gender parity index in Slovenia peaked at 1 GPIA in 2013 and was at its lowest, 0.9892 GPIA, in 2005.
That places Slovenia 120th out of 214 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
Gross enrolment ratio, primary, adjusted gender parity index in Slovenia, year by year
| Year | GPIA |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 | 0.9973 GPIA | — |
| 2002 | 0.9913 GPIA | -0.6% |
| 2003 | 0.9932 GPIA | +0.2% |
| 2004 | 0.9943 GPIA | +0.1% |
| 2005 | 0.9892 GPIA | -0.5% |
| 2006 | 0.9953 GPIA | +0.6% |
| 2007 | 0.9949 GPIA | -0.0% |
| 2008 | 0.9989 GPIA | +0.4% |
| 2009 | 0.9975 GPIA | -0.1% |
| 2010 | 1 GPIA | +0.3% |
| 2011 | 0.9994 GPIA | -0.1% |
| 2012 | 1 GPIA | +0.1% |
| 2013 | 1 GPIA | +0.1% |
| 2014 | 0.998 GPIA | -0.4% |
| 2015 | 0.999 GPIA | +0.1% |
| 2016 | 1 GPIA | +0.2% |
| 2017 | 1 GPIA | +0.0% |
| 2018 | 0.9979 GPIA | -0.3% |
| 2019 | 0.9969 GPIA | -0.1% |
| 2020 | 0.9969 GPIA | +0.0% |
| 2021 | 0.9991 GPIA | +0.2% |
| 2022 | 0.9936 GPIA | -0.6% |
| 2023 | 0.9928 GPIA | -0.1% |
